How Can I Troubleshoot Tension Issues for a Smooth Sewing Experience?

Tension problems can really throw off your sewing groove, believe me! Here’s how to fix them:

  1. Check Your Thread: Make sure you’re using the right thread for your fabric. If you think something’s off, take out the top thread and rethread your machine. Sometimes, it’s just a quick fix!

  2. Adjust Tension Settings: Start with the settings that come standard on your machine. If your stitches are too tight, lower the tension a bit. If they are too loose, raise it a little.

  3. Inspect the Bobbin: If the bobbin is not in the right spot, it can create issues. Check that it's wound correctly and placed properly.

  4. Test, Test, Test: Always try a test stitch on some scrap fabric before you start on your project. This way, you can see if the tension is working well.
